LSBA Elections: Online Voting Open from Nov. 15-Dec. 13


First-round voting will begin on Nov. 15 for nine contested leadership positions for the Board of Governors, Nominating Committee, Young Lawyers Division Council, the American Bar Association House of Delegates and the Young Lawyers Representative to the ABA House of Delegates.

Balloting will be conducted electronically only, as approved by the LSBA Board of Governors and provided for in the Association’s Articles of Incorporation. No paper ballots will be provided.

Deadline for electronically casting votes is Monday, Dec. 13.

To review all candidates in Contested Races, as well as members who have been Certified Elected for their races, go to: https://www.lsba.org/BarGovernance/Elections.aspx.

Profiles on candidates in contested races will be accessible online on Nov. 15.

How To Vote Online:

Members will receive an email with their E-ballot on Monday, Nov. 15. The sender address will be “LSBA Election Admin” and the Subject Line will reference “Vote now in the LSBA 2021-2022 Election.” The email will include a link to the voting website. On the voting website, members must type in their 5-digit member ID number and birth date to access the ballot. Ballots will only include races for which the member may cast a vote. Members who do not have an email address, or members preferring to vote from the LSBA website, may log-in from the LSBA website to a special page and will be asked to enter the same credentials. The “Vote Now” icon will be active from Nov. 15 through Dec. 13.
